TECHNICAL FIELD The present invention relates to a basic field of civil engineering and construction, and more particularly, to a steel pipe micro pile and a basic construction method using the same.
A micro pile generally refers to a small diameter file (generally having a diameter of 300 mm or less). Since a foundation structure using the micro pile has a merit that it can support a large load as compared with a small space, It is mainly applied to the conditions (underground of buildings) where large equipment can not enter due to restrictions.
However, the conventional microfilming method has the following problems.
First, since the conventional microfibers generally have a steel rod structure, a separate hose is required for grouting, which results in poor workability and is not excellent in the sectional structure after construction.
Second, when it is necessary to work in the basement to reinforce the foundation of existing buildings, it is difficult to insert long microfiles at once.

This leads to the following effects.
First, unlike a conventional micro-file with a steel rod structure, since a micro-file having a steel pipe structure is applied, a separate hose is not required for grouting, so that it is excellent in workability and structurally superior in cross section can be obtained after construction.
